Susceptibility of Some Apple wild rootstock And Varieties Spread in As-Suwayda Governorate To infestation by The Woolly Apple Aphid Eriosoma lanigerum (Hausmann).

Abstract

Apple varieties differ in their susceptibility to the Woolly apple aphid. Therefore, this study aimed to compare some of the varieties and rootstocks spread in As-Suwayda Governorate for infestation by this insect. Plants of 3 varieties grafted on wild seedstock (Golden Delicious, Top Red, Royal Red) were planted for two seasons in 2021- 2022. In addition to cultivating the wild seed origin and the certified origin in state nurseries (a mixture of tree mother seeds from the village of Al-Mafala). The woolly apple aphid infestation was transferred to the planted plants, and it was confirmed that they were infested with the insect, The results of the analysis of variance over the two years showed that the Royal Red variety (red color) had a higher infection rate than the other two varieties, as it recorded the highest infection rate, especially in the second year, 2022. at a rate of 61.90%, while the Golden Delicious variety (yellow color) was the most resistant variety with an infection rate of 36.00%. There was also a significant difference between the infection rate on the wild rootstock compared to the infection rate on the rootstock used in the state nurseries, where the LSD value was = 0.06.
